Cong to undertake new poll strategy: Vasan

Says important national political parties still negotiating alliances

The Congress would undertake a new poll strategy for the Lok Sabha elections and the party would execute it at the right time to emerge victorious, Shipping Minister G K Vasan said today.
 
"For the 2014 Lok Sabha polls, the Congress will undertake a new poll strategy. It would execute the strategy at the right time that would make the party emerge victorious," Vasan said, after unveiling a nine-foot statue of veteran Congress leader and former Tamil Nadu Chief Minister K Kamaraj at Kamarajar Port here today.
 
At the renaming function of Ennore Port Ltd to Kamarajar Port recently, Vasan had said the leader's new statue would be set up in the administrative block of the port situated near here.
 
Asked about alliance talks with other parties, he said there was enough time as national parties were yet to decide on it.
 
"Important national political parties have not decided about their alliances and are negotiating. There is time to decide (about it) as Election Commission is yet to announce the poll dates," he told reporters.
 
Vasan also distributed note books, geometry box and a book on Kamaraj to school children on the occasion.
 
The Congress is still scouting for allies while ruling AIADMK has struck an alliance with the left parties. DMK has till now finalised alliance with the Indian Union Muslim League, Viduthalai Chiruthaigal Katchi, Manithaneyaneya Makkal Katchi, and Puthiya Tamizhagam.
 
Union Minister M Sudarsana Natchiappan yesterday indicated that Congress was open for alliances with DMK and DMDK.
 
DMDK chief Vijayakanth, however, is yet to make known the electoral allies of his party while BJP national president Rajnath Singh recently authorised the Tamil Nadu unit to complete the "process of forging alliance with prospective parties" in a week.
